The line chart provides a comparison of the amount of waste produced by three companies from 2000 to 2015.
Overall, there were decreases in the waste produced amounts by company A and company B, while the opposite was true for company C. Additionally, the amount of waste disposed by company A was the highest for most of the period.
In 2000, company A discarded 12 tonnes of waste, which was over 3 tonnes higher than company B and almost triple that of company C. By 2015, company A had significantly reduced its waste production to just below 9 tonnes. Meanwhile, company B saw its waste production peak in 2005, followed by a drop of more than threefold by 2015. In contrast, company C experienced a dramatic increase in waste production, ending at just above company B’s highest point in 2005.
